Ingredients
For the Chicken
- 1.5 lb skinless boneless chicken thighs
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
For the Vegetables
- 8 oz grape tomatoes (sliced in half)
- 5 cloves garlic (minced)
- 5 oz fresh spinach (chopped)
For the Rice
- 2 cups cooked jasmine rice
For Garnish
- 15 oz chickpeas (canned)
- 6 oz feta cheese (diced into small cubes)
- 3 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
- 1/4 teaspoon dried oregano
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h oregano (optional)
- fresh oregano (for garnish)
How to Make Greek Chicken and Lemon Rice (30 Minutes, One-Pot)
Step 1: Prepare the Chicken
- In a bowl, combine the chicken thighs with dried oregano, paprika, salt, and red pepper flakes.
-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
- Add the seasoned chicken to the pot. Cook until browned on both sides, about 5 minutes.
Step 2: Add Garlic and Tomatoes
- Once the chicken is browned, add minced garlic to the pot.
- Stir in sliced grape tomatoes and cook for another 3 minutes until they soften.
Step 3: Incorporate Spinach and Chickpeas
- Add chopped spinach to the mixture in the pot.
- Stir in canned chickpeas along with freshly squeezed lemon juice.
Step 4: Combine with Rice
- Add cooked jasmine rice to the pot. Mix well until everything is evenly combined.
- Cook for an additional 2–3 minutes until heated through.
Step 5: Serve
- Remove from heat and stir in diced feta cheese and extra virgin olive oil.
- Sprinkle with chopped fresh oregano if desired.
- Garnish with fresh oregano before serving.

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ftover Greek Chicken and Lemon Rice in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Allow the dish to cool completely before sealing the container to maintain freshness.
Freezing Greek Chicken and Lemon Rice (30 Minutes, One-Pot)
- Place cooled leftovers in a freezer-safe container.
- Label with the date; it will last up to 3 months in the freezer.
Reheating Greek Chicken and Lemon Rice (30 Minutes, One-Pot)
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ake covered for about 20 minutes or until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at in short intervals, stirring occasionally until warm throughout, usually about 2-3 minutes.
- Stovetop: Reheat over medium heat in a skillet, adding a splash of water or broth if needed to prevent sticking.
